summaryrefslogtreecommitdiff
path: root/www/mozilla/patches/patch-ad
diff options
context:
space:
mode:
Diffstat (limited to 'www/mozilla/patches/patch-ad')
-rw-r--r--www/mozilla/patches/patch-ad13
1 files changed, 9 insertions, 4 deletions
diff --git a/www/mozilla/patches/patch-ad b/www/mozilla/patches/patch-ad
index c2366c97942..2146ee0bb90 100644
--- a/www/mozilla/patches/patch-ad
+++ b/www/mozilla/patches/patch-ad
@@ -1,20 +1,25 @@
-$NetBSD: patch-ad,v 1.21 2002/08/29 15:11:14 taya Exp $
+$NetBSD: patch-ad,v 1.22 2002/10/03 15:54:00 taya Exp $
diff -ru ../Orig/mozilla/xpcom/reflect/xptcall/src/md/unix/xptcinvoke_netbsd_m68k.cpp ./xpcom/reflect/xptcall/src/md/unix/xptcinvoke_netbsd_m68k.cpp
--- ../Orig/mozilla/xpcom/reflect/xptcall/src/md/unix/xptcinvoke_netbsd_m68k.cpp Sat Sep 29 05:12:51 2001
-+++ ./xpcom/reflect/xptcall/src/md/unix/xptcinvoke_netbsd_m68k.cpp Wed Aug 28 11:21:47 2002
-@@ -132,6 +132,10 @@
++++ ./xpcom/reflect/xptcall/src/md/unix/xptcinvoke_netbsd_m68k.cpp Sun Sep 8 00:46:20 2002
+@@ -132,6 +132,15 @@
}
}
+/*
+ * SYMBOL PREFIX must be "_" for aout symbols and "" for ELF
+ */
++#ifndef __ELF__
++#define SYMBOLPREFIX "_"
++#else
++#define SYMBOLPREFIX
++#endif
+
XPTC_PUBLIC_API(nsresult)
XPTC_InvokeByIndex(nsISupports* that, PRUint32 methodIndex,
PRUint32 paramCount, nsXPTCVariant* params)
-@@ -139,30 +143,30 @@
+@@ -139,30 +148,30 @@
PRUint32 result;
__asm__ __volatile__(